Connecting with OMRON Controllers

This section describes the settings required to connect the Servo Drive with an OMRON controller.
Machine Automation Controller NJ/NX-series CPU Unit
The following tables show the setting values required to use the control functions of the controller.
If you change these settings, read and understand the relevant specifications in advance and set
appropriate values.
